The Systems Administrator provides critical infrastructure, hardware, and application support through planning, design, testing, installation, and ongoing maintenance of enterprise systems. This role is responsible for ensuring the reliability, security, and optimization of the organization's computing platforms, data storage, and network environments. Working under general direction, the Systems Administrator handles complex technical issues, acts as a technical advisor for hardware and software procurement, and collaborates with executive leadership and internal stakeholders to align IT infrastructure with organizational goals.
Essential Job Duties are intended to be examples of duties and are not intended to be all inclusive. There may be other duties as assigned.
Bachelor’s degree in Information Systems, Computer Technology, Systems Engineering, or a related field and 1-3 years of directly related professional experience in systems administration, IT infrastructure support, or systems analysis is required. An equivalent combination of education and experience is acceptable.
Conditions are those of a typical office environment, requiring frequent oral communication with students and colleagues, the ability to enter data and written communications in electronic format in a timely manner, and sufficient mobility to be present and address students, their parents, and fellow professionals at appropriate college and regional functions. Moderate physical activity. Requires handling of average-weight objects up to 15 pounds; standing, sitting and/or walking for brief or long periods.
